OpenVPN клиент: особенности, настройка и применение
OpenVPN клиент — это программное обеспечение, предназначенное для установления защищённого VPN-соединения с сервером OpenVPN. Оно используется для обеспечения безопасного обмена данными через публичные или частные сети, включая интернет. Клиент OpenVPN позволяет пользователю подключаться к удалённой сети, шифруя весь трафик и обеспечивая его конфиденциальность и целостность.
OpenVPN клиент использует протоколы шифрования на базе библиотеки OpenSSL и туннелирует сетевой трафик через защищённое соединение. Работа клиента основывается на архитектуре клиент-сервер, где:
клиент инициирует подключение;
сервер аутентифицирует клиента и устанавливает VPN-туннель;
все данные между ними передаются в зашифрованном виде.
OpenVPN клиент доступен для большинства операционных систем:
Windows (через официальное приложение OpenVPN GUI);
macOS (через Tunnelblick или OpenVPN Connect);
Linux (через командную строку или GUI-интерфейсы, такие как NetworkManager);
Android и iOS (через мобильное приложение OpenVPN Connect).
Скачать инсталлятор с официального сайта OpenVPN.
Установить программу с правами администратора.
Поместить конфигурационные файлы .ovpn
в папку config
.
Запустить OpenVPN GUI и выбрать нужный профиль для подключения.
Установить пакет openvpn
через системный менеджер пакетов (например, apt
, dnf
или pacman
).
Разместить конфигурационные файлы в соответствующей директории (обычно /etc/openvpn/
).
Использовать команду sudo openvpn --config <имя_файла>.ovpnимя_файла>
для запуска соединения.
OpenVPN клиент использует конфигурационные файлы формата .ovpn
, содержащие:
адрес и порт сервера;
протокол (UDP или TCP);
параметры шифрования;
пути к сертификатам и ключам;
дополнительные параметры безопасности и маршрутизации.
OpenVPN клиент поддерживает различные методы аутентификации:
с использованием сертификатов X.509;
с использованием логина и пароля;
двухфакторная аутентификация (2FA) через токены или мобильные приложения.
Шифрование данных осуществляется с помощью алгоритмов AES, RSA и других стандартов, поддерживаемых OpenSSL.
Высокий уровень безопасности благодаря надёжным криптографическим алгоритмам.
Гибкость конфигурации, включая поддержку различных сетевых топологий.
Совместимость с межсетевыми экранами и NAT за счёт возможности использования порта 443 TCP.
Открытый исходный код, что обеспечивает прозрачность и аудит безопасности.
Проблемы с подключением — могут быть вызваны блокировкой портов, ошибками конфигурации или отсутствием прав доступа.
Низкая скорость соединения — возможно из-за выбора неподходящего протокола (например, TCP вместо UDP).
Проблемы с DNS — рекомендуется использовать перенаправление DNS через VPN или сторонние серверы (например, 1.1.1.1).
OpenVPN клиент активно применяется в бизнесе для:
удалённого доступа сотрудников к внутренним ресурсам;
подключения филиалов к центральному офису;
защиты корпоративного трафика в публичных сетях.
Поддержка политик безопасности, масштабируемость и интеграция с системами авторизации (RADIUS, LDAP) делают OpenVPN надёжным решением для предприятий.
Решение | Протокол | Шифрование | Открытый код | Поддержка платформ |
---|---|---|---|---|
OpenVPN | UDP/TCP | AES, RSA | Да | Windows, macOS, Linux, Android, iOS |
WireGuard | UDP | ChaCha20 | Да | Windows, macOS, Linux, Android, iOS |
L2TP/IPSec | UDP | AES | Нет | Широкая поддержка |
PPTP | TCP | Устаревшее | Нет | Ограниченная поддержка |
Что необходимо для подключения OpenVPN клиента?
Требуются установленные программное обеспечение клиента, конфигурационный файл .ovpn
, сертификаты и ключи, предоставленные администратором.
Безопасен ли OpenVPN клиент для передачи конфиденциальных данных?
Да. При корректной настройке и использовании актуальных методов шифрования OpenVPN клиент обеспечивает высокий уровень безопасности.
Можно ли использовать OpenVPN клиент без установки?
Да. Существуют портативные версии клиента для некоторых платформ, однако функциональность может быть ограничена.
Какой протокол лучше выбрать — TCP или UDP?
UDP предпочтителен для большинства сценариев, так как обеспечивает лучшую производительность. TCP рекомендуется при наличии ограничений в сети (например, при наличии файрволов).
Можно ли использовать OpenVPN клиент на мобильных устройствах?
Да. Существуют официальные приложения для Android и iOS, поддерживающие те же конфигурации, что и на десктопных системах.
Посетители, находящиеся в группе Гости, не могут оставлять комментарии к данной публикации.